Description Respiratory Care Practitioner at Petaluma Valley
Hospital, CA. This position is Per Diem and will work 12-hour,
Variable shifts. An RCP II is defined as an RCP that has acquired
the Registered Respiratory Therapist credential (RRT) from the
National Board of Respiratory Care. The RCP II will provide
routine, emergent and critical (neonatal to adult ) respiratory
care to the area of assignment under the direction of the
Respiratory Care Management. Providence caregivers are not simply

people, we must empower them. Required Qualifications: -
Coursework/Training: Graduate of an accredited College, in the
field of Respiratory Therapy. - Coursework/Training: Training
specific to area of assignment. - California Respiratory Care
Practitioner License upon hire - National Provider BLS - American
Heart Association upon hire - National Provider ACLS - American
Heart Association within 90 days of hire - National Provider PALS -
American Heart Association within 90 days of hire - Experience in
an acute (routine and critical) respiratory care setting. Why Join
